Donald Mackenzie Ltd is a long established family owned company who are looking for an experienced Vehicle Technician to join our busy Aftersales Team. We are the Approved Stellantis Main Dealer for Fiat, Abarth, Alfa Romeo, Jeep and Fiat Professional in the Highlands.

Job Responsibilities include:

  • As a Vehicle Technician, you will be working in a very busy, Stellantis multi-brand workshop environment where you will be responsible for servicing, maintaining and repairing motor vehicles to a high standard.

Key responsibilities:

  • Carry out vehicle services and repairs to manufacturer standards
  • Diagnose and repair non-routine defects
  • Ensure jobs are completed efficiently and accurately

What we’re looking for:

  • NVQ Level 3 in Light Vehicle Repair or equivalent (required)
  • MOT licence (desirable)
  • Experience in vehicle servicing and maintenance
  • Main dealer experience (preferred)
  • Full UK driving licence
  • Team player with a customer-focused attitude

Our Offer to You:

  • 30 days annual leave
  • 44 hour working week with competitive salary
  • Stellantis brand training
  • Contributory pension scheme
